Fritz d’Orey

SummaryStatisticsTeamsPositionsTeam MatesYear by YearRanking by season

Name Fritz d’Orey
Country Brazil Brazil
Place of Birth São Paulo
Date of Birth 25/03/1938
Date of Death 31/08/2020
First Race Grand Prix de France 05/07/1959
Last Race Grand Prix of the United States 12/12/1959
Best Qualifying 17th - Grand Prix of the United States 12/12/1959
Best Result 10th - Grand Prix de France 05/07/1959

Races 4
Race Starts 3
Drivers' Titles 0
Victories 0
Poles 0
Fastest Laps 0
Podiums 0
Points 0
Average Points 0.00
Laps 103
Laps Led 0

Maserati (1959), Tec-Mec (1959)
